深度解析:高效使用DeepSeek场景数字包的实践指南
2025.09.19 15:23浏览量:0简介:本文聚焦DeepSeek场景数字包的高效使用方法,从配置优化、功能调用、性能调优到实际应用场景,系统阐述开发者如何最大化其价值,助力企业实现智能化转型。
引言
DeepSeek场景数字包作为一款面向开发者与企业用户的智能化工具集,通过提供场景化的数字能力封装,显著降低了AI技术在业务场景中的落地门槛。然而,如何高效使用这一工具包,充分发挥其技术潜力,仍是许多开发者面临的挑战。本文将从配置优化、功能调用、性能调优及实际应用场景四个维度,系统阐述高效使用DeepSeek场景数字包的核心方法。
一、配置优化:构建高效运行环境
1.1 硬件资源适配
DeepSeek场景数字包的运行效率与硬件资源直接相关。开发者需根据场景复杂度选择适配的硬件配置:
- 轻量级场景(如文本分类、简单推理):建议使用CPU环境,配置4核8G内存即可满足需求。
- 复杂场景(如多模态交互、大规模数据处理):需部署GPU环境,推荐NVIDIA A100或V100显卡,配合16G以上显存。
- 分布式部署:对于高并发场景,可通过Kubernetes集群实现资源动态调度,避免单点瓶颈。
1.2 软件环境配置
- 依赖管理:使用
pip
或conda
管理依赖库,确保版本兼容性。例如:pip install deepseek-sdk==1.2.0 numpy==1.21.0
- 环境隔离:通过虚拟环境(如
venv
或docker
)隔离不同项目的依赖,避免冲突。 - 日志与监控:集成Prometheus+Grafana监控系统,实时跟踪API调用耗时、错误率等关键指标。
二、功能调用:精准匹配业务需求
2.1 核心功能模块
DeepSeek场景数字包提供三大核心模块:
- 自然语言处理(NLP):支持文本分类、实体识别、情感分析等功能。
- 计算机视觉(CV):涵盖图像分类、目标检测、OCR识别等能力。
- 多模态交互:结合语音、文本、图像的跨模态推理。
2.2 高效调用技巧
- 批量处理:对大规模数据,优先使用
batch_process
接口减少IO开销。例如:from deepseek import NLPProcessor
processor = NLPProcessor()
results = processor.batch_classify(texts=["文本1", "文本2"], batch_size=32)
- 异步调用:通过
asyncio
实现非阻塞调用,提升并发能力。import asyncio
async def process_text(text):
return await processor.async_classify(text)
tasks = [process_text(t) for t in texts]
await asyncio.gather(*tasks)
- 缓存机制:对高频查询结果(如固定模板的文本分类)启用Redis缓存,减少重复计算。
三、性能调优:突破效率瓶颈
3.1 模型优化
- 量化压缩:使用TensorRT或ONNX Runtime对模型进行8位量化,减少内存占用并加速推理。
- 剪枝与蒸馏:通过模型剪枝去除冗余参数,或使用知识蒸馏将大模型能力迁移至轻量级模型。
- 动态批处理:根据请求负载动态调整批处理大小,平衡延迟与吞吐量。
3.2 代码级优化
- 向量化计算:利用NumPy或PyTorch的向量化操作替代循环,例如:
# 优化前:逐元素计算
results = []
for text in texts:
results.append(processor.score(text))
# 优化后:向量化计算
scores = processor.batch_score(texts)
- 内存管理:及时释放不再使用的变量,避免内存泄漏。例如:
import gc
del large_tensor
gc.collect()
四、实际应用场景:从理论到落地
4.1 智能客服系统
- 场景需求:实现7×24小时自动应答,支持多轮对话与意图识别。
- 实现方案:
- 使用NLP模块进行意图分类与实体提取。
- 结合知识图谱实现上下文关联。
- 通过异步调用优化高并发场景下的响应速度。
4.2 工业质检
- 场景需求:对生产线上的产品进行缺陷检测,要求高精度与低延迟。
- 实现方案:
- 使用CV模块的目标检测功能定位缺陷区域。
- 通过模型量化将推理时间压缩至50ms以内。
- 部署边缘计算设备实现本地化处理,减少网络延迟。
4.3 金融风控
- 场景需求:实时分析交易数据,识别欺诈行为。
- 实现方案:
- 结合多模态模块分析用户行为数据(如操作轨迹、设备信息)。
- 使用动态批处理应对交易高峰期的请求洪峰。
- 通过A/B测试持续优化模型阈值。
五、最佳实践总结
- 渐进式优化:从单节点测试开始,逐步扩展至分布式集群。
- 监控驱动:基于实时指标调整配置参数,避免“一刀切”式优化。
- 文档化经验:记录每次调优的参数变化与效果对比,形成知识库。
- 社区协作:参与DeepSeek开发者社区,共享优化案例与问题解决方案。
结语
高效使用DeepSeek场景数字包的核心在于“精准适配”与“持续优化”。通过合理的硬件配置、功能模块选择、性能调优策略及场景化落地,开发者可显著提升AI技术的业务价值。未来,随着工具包的迭代升级,其应用边界将进一步扩展,为智能化转型提供更强支撑。
发表评论
登录后可评论,请前往 登录 或 注册